The Original Hollywood Fantasy

From Michael Beschloss:

This is Hollywoodland, Los Angeles, California in about 1926, three years after it was established.

Hollywoodland

.

A good case can be made that places like this between the wars – the Hollywood and Berkeley Hills, Pasadena,  Carmel – achieved the finest quality of life affluent North Americans have ever experienced.  Near Edens.
